CD&L Carolina Power & Light Company SERIAL: NLS-87-030 J AN 2 81987 10CFR50.90 United States Nuclear Regulatory Commission ATTENTION: Document Control Desk Washington, DC 20555 BRUNSWICK STEAM ELECTRIC PLANT, UNIT NOS.1 AND 2 DOCKET NOS. 50-325 & 50-324/ LICENSE NOS. DPR-71 & DPR-62 SUPPLEMENT TO REQUEST FOR LICENSE AMENDMENT TEMPERATURE SENSOR RESPONSE TIME TESTING Gentlemen:

On November 13,1986, Carolina Power & Light Company requested a license amendment to delete the requirement to perform response time testing on various temperature switches and thermocouples listed in Table 3.3.2-3. Subsequent to this submittal, a conference call was held with members of your staff to discuss whether any accident analysis addresses the affected temperature sensors' response times. The Company has re-verified that the Brunswick Plant Updated Final Safety Analysis Report does not take credit for temperature sensor response in any accident analysis.
